Dividend Analysis
Payout Safety
Raymond James Financial, Inc. distributes 19.5% of earnings as dividends (Sustainable). When measured against free cash flow—a stricter test—the payout ratio stands at 28.6%, rated "Well Covered".
Piotroski F-Score: 6/9 — moderate financial health.
Growth Track Record
RJF has raised its dividend for 22 consecutive years, with a 3-year CAGR of 4.0% and 5-year CAGR of 22.0%.
Total Shareholder Returns
Beyond cash dividends, RJF returns capital through share repurchases. The combined picture: 1.3% dividend yield, 4.2% buyback yield, 5.5% total shareholder yield.
Income Trend & Total Return
Yield on cost (5-year basis) has reached 3.2% and is currently rising. The 5-year total return is 99.8%, with dividends contributing 10.1% of that performance.
